description The research is on the implementation of Latihan Dalam Perkhidmatan (LADAP) in a secondary school in Petaling Jaya District. The study is focusing on the role of the school administrator in planning, selection of contents and also the challenges faced in implementing the program. Providing LADAP program for teachers in school is a one of the ways to upgrading teachers' professionalism. Therefore it is vital to study how proper planning and selection of contents are carried out by the school administrator to enhance teachers' skill and knowledge, thus to elevate their professionalism standard. Data for the study is gathered from teachers and school administrator using a mix method analysis. 113 teachers and 6 school administrators' were involved in this study as respondents. Qualitative data gathered from the interview session with school administrator was used as the main data analysed. Quantitative data gathered through questionnaire were processed using SPSS 16.0 software. Later on, the convergence process of both data from both sources, qualitative and quantitative methods has been done. The findings of the study shows that school administrator has done their job quite well but there is still room for improvement especially in planning more effective training program and also to improve on the process of contents selection of the program. School administrators also must take the initiatives to solve problems that are considered as challenges, whenever is possible. Even though most of the challenges are actually beyond the school administrator's authority, suggestions can be given to those responsible parties to further improvement of the program, thus achieving the objectives of the implementation of school based LADAP.
